成人免费xxxxx在线视频软件_久久精品久久久_亚洲国产精品久久久_天天色天天色_亚洲人成一区_欧美一级欧美三级在线观看

Fiddler前端開發值得擁有

開發 前端
Fiddler是一個web調試代理。它能夠記錄所有客戶端和服務器間的http請求,允許你監視,設置斷點,甚至修改輸入輸出數據,fiddler包含了一個強大的基于事件腳本的子系統,并且能夠使用.net框架語言擴展。

寫這篇文章的目的何在:

1.本人還算喜歡看書,JavaScript的相關書看過一些,書本上總能看見對JavaScript類似的評語或者評價 - “JavaScript調試困難”??墒鞘聦崊s是隨著互聯網行業的的飛速發展,JavaScript調試難的問題已不像早年那樣麻煩了,這里先不說各種IDE對JavaScript強力的支持,剛好因為工作需要,需要調試產品在主流瀏覽器中兼容問題,所以乘機做了點功課,來為大伙介紹這個在前端開發過程中異常給力的工具。

2.***次已介紹一款軟件為目的寫文章,希望大家看完文章能有收獲。而且說到底這個也是一個工具,大家如果有用過更好的調試工具也歡迎推廣一下,大家好才是真的好,哈哈。

3.這款工具本人已經使用快兩年時間了,在實際工作確實得到不少幫助,所以雖然已有介紹此工具的文章,還是決定自己寫一篇,讓更多的朋友了解這個工具。

4.這個月對本人來說是一個嶄新的開始,新的生活,新的工作,新的環境...上個月發生了太多太多事情,好事壞事煩心事,感覺一切都很漫長,不過堅持過后更加堅定自己努力的決心,自己強大起來才是硬道理。

5.文章的前部分介紹工具的具體細節,后部分介紹工具的使用技巧和具體的方法,針對個人需求選擇閱讀。

6.歡迎轉載,不過請注明出處,謝謝。

Fiddler是啥?

百度百科里是這樣介紹它的 - “Fiddler是一個web調試代理。它能夠記錄所有客戶端和服務器間的http請求,允許你監視,設置斷點,甚至修改輸入輸出數據,fiddler包含了一個強大的基于事件腳本的子系統,并且能夠使用.net框架語言擴展。”

所以無論你是從事什么開發,哪種語言,只要你想了解HTTP,這個工具就值得你去了解,而且更重要的一點,這個工具是免費的。

Fiddler就是以代理服務器的方式,監聽系統的網絡數據流動。

啟動Fiddler后,所發生的網絡數據流通過Fiddler進行中轉,就可以看到HTTP/HTTPS數據流的信息,我們就可以通過對這些信息加以分析。Fiddler還提供了清除IE緩存、請求構造器、文本轉換工具等等一系列工具,對前端開發工作很有價值。

Fiddler的安裝與下載:

Fiddler下載地址:http://www.fiddler2.com/fiddler2/

假如你是早期的XP版本的系統在安裝的過程中會提示你下載.net framework 2.0或以上版本 。安裝過程很簡單,就不介紹了。

Fiddler的使用界面和功能介紹:

 

fiddler

 

監聽開關 - 只有兩種狀態,用的時候就開著,不用就讓丫休息。capturing表示捕捉狀態

監聽類型 - 四種狀態分別對應 監聽所有請求;監聽瀏覽器請求,監聽非瀏覽器請求,和全部隱藏(Hide All)

命令行 - 就不作介紹了,難者不會,會者不難。我就屬于前者,悲劇呀...

請求列表 - 請求列表的信息分別有 結果(Result),協議(Protocol),主機名(Host),網頁地址(URL),內容大小(Body),緩存(Caching),響應的HTTP內容類型(Content-Type),請求所運行的程序(Process),注釋(Comments),自定義(Custom)

請求相關信息 - 右邊這一大片都是數據流的相關信息的查看器,這些查看器提供很多查看形式,可以查看數據流的內容。

Fiddler請求列表的icon對應具體的數據類型和狀態,其含義是:

 

icon對應的數據請求的含義

 

#p#

Fiddler請求相關信息對應的主要功能:

工具最右方的是請求相關信息的查看器,提供了數據多方面的查看方式。想了解?看圖片。

統計資料信息(Statistics)

 

Statistics

 

強大的檢查器(Inspectors) - 功能很多,等待你慢慢挖掘。

 

Inspectors

 

 

Inspectors

 

時間軸(Timeline)

 

Timeline

 

自動回復器(autoResponder) - 一會就是介紹它的具體使用方法

 

autoResponder

 

說說我在工作中為什么使用Fiddler,如何使用Fiddler。

前端工程師在工作中總會有那么一些要求,要求書寫的代碼具有優良的兼容性,要求考慮代碼的高性能,要求方法要面向對象,要求...前端工程師總是和瀏覽器兼容有很多不得不說的事。

條件1:在我們前端工程師開發的工作中,要調試服務器上某個HTML/CSS/JavaScript文件。一般情況下,我們都是將文件直接進行修改,然后重新發布再去做驗證,這樣就容易影響到測試環境或者生成環境的穩定性。更好的做法是,我們在本地開發環境中直接修改文件并進行驗證,然后發布到測試環境,這樣能保證測試環境的穩定,可是又比較繁瑣。

條件2:現在我的情況是需要調試上線產品的瀏覽器兼容性問題,且我沒有本地環境或者生成環境去測試。假如有Bug發生在Firefox或者Chrome這種有控制臺支持調試的瀏覽器下一切都好說,可是假如bug只發生在遨游,TT,世界之窗,搜狗...這種的沒有調試功能的瀏覽器下,而且你還碰見了我目前的情況,那么如果沒有Fiddler這種工具,只能說這就是一場災難。

#p#

Fiddler工具可以修改HTTP數據的特性,我們就非常便捷地基于生產環境修改并驗證,確認后再發布。

***步,先定位調試文件且下載。假設發現頁面中的某個文件有問題(HTML/CSS/JavaScript都行),那么我們需要做的是就把他先下載到本地(如果本地有這個本地那么可以跳過此步驟),下載到本地的文件偶爾會有亂碼的情況,建議你先清理瀏覽器緩存或者調整注冊表(Fiddler2中文亂碼問題)。使用細節如下:

 

save

 

第二步,Fiddler - autoResponder出場,開啟此功能。打開AutoResponder標簽設置??梢钥吹浇缑嫔嫌腥齻€選擇框,***個的作用是開啟或禁用自動重定向功能,我們就可以在下面添加重定向規則了;第二個選擇框被勾上時,不匹配的請求可以通過,不影響那些沒滿足我們處理條件的請求。

 

自動回復器

 

第三步,創建重定向規則,將目標是這個js的HTTP請求重定向到本地文件。選中剛剛定位的文件,通過“Add…”按鈕增加規則,也可以直接拖動過來。

 

selectResponder

 

第四步,選擇本地剛剛保存的文件或者替換的文件,作為替換這個請求的內容。

 

selectFile

 

第五步,你調試或者不調試,它就在那里 - 只會請求你本地的選擇的那個文件。所以,想怎么修改都隨便你了。刷新頁面,就可以看見這個alert了。

 

alert

 

總結:雖然介紹時一共分為5個步驟,其實只要用習慣了很隨意就可以調試了??焖偾岸苏{試其實很簡單,你說類。

原文鏈接:http://www.cnblogs.com/Darren_code/archive/2011/09/28/Fiddler.html

【編輯推薦】

  1. 前端開發中的MCRV模式
  2. 老外支招:讓您的Web應用程序飛起來
  3. JavaScript大辯論:實施改進還是徹底放棄
  4. 9月Web技術最前沿:jQuery成版本帝
  5. 程序員勵志篇:IT圈也有“盲劍客”
責任編輯:陳貽新 來源: 聶微東的博客
相關推薦

2019-03-25 13:12:59

前端開發編程

2021-09-06 10:22:47

匿名對象編程

2023-12-29 08:17:26

Python代碼分析Profile

2013-07-05 16:08:40

開發效率

2021-01-21 09:45:16

Python字符串代碼

2013-01-18 17:00:20

設計師創業團隊

2020-12-14 13:32:40

Python進度條參數

2021-07-05 09:40:57

工具Node開源

2020-09-01 07:41:56

macOS工具

2014-12-19 10:55:17

Linux性能監控

2024-12-18 16:53:13

ncduLinux磁盤分析

2024-01-04 08:33:11

異步JDK數據結構

2018-01-08 10:39:17

前端技術框架

2022-06-28 09:44:21

DevOps軟件開發

2020-10-09 11:54:33

Vue用戶的React

2022-02-09 18:55:30

LazygitGit命令維護項目

2013-04-18 10:01:01

Fiddler前端

2024-06-13 09:50:45

2020-02-03 12:25:35

Python工具服務器

2012-06-04 15:06:47

Chrome插件應用程序
點贊
收藏

51CTO技術棧公眾號

主站蜘蛛池模板: 免费看国产一级特黄aaaa大片 | 国产成人免费视频 | 午夜视频在线 | 日韩av手机在线观看 | 久久免费精品 | 精品视频免费 | 日韩电影一区二区三区 | 一道本不卡视频 | 精品一区电影 | 卡通动漫第一页 | 中文字幕av亚洲精品一部二部 | 欧美激情一区二区三区 | 精品视频一区二区 | 国产精品久久久久久久免费大片 | 精品成人免费一区二区在线播放 | 成人免费av | 九九久久久久久 | 欧美一级免费看 | 黄a在线播放 | 欧洲一区二区三区 | 国产精品一区二区三区在线播放 | 国产精品7777777 | 久久精品一区二区视频 | 久久久久国产精品一区 | 一区二区在线不卡 | 一级黄色毛片 | 国产一区二区三区四区五区3d | 亚洲精品视频在线播放 | 国产精品久久久久久久久久久久 | 色综合一区二区三区 | 亚洲精品美女视频 | 亚洲精品乱码久久久久久按摩观 | 在线视频 中文字幕 | 天天天操操操 | 亚洲成人一区二区 | 久久大| 99自拍视频 | 拍拍无遮挡人做人爱视频免费观看 | 一区二区三区四区av | 免费看一区二区三区 | 日韩成人在线观看 |